How to Use Our Community Forums

All  forums are public and visible to everybody. No registration is required to read the postings.

All postings are moderated. Every time a new posting is made in one of our forums, we receive an email. We both read all postings and approve all of them, unless they are offensive or completely beside the point and irrelevant to the looking.

We encourage you to join the conversation and make your own postings.  In order to be able to make postings, you will need to register. Don't worry, it's simple and easy to register.

How to make your own postings

 

Once you confirm your registration and activate your account, log into the RiverGanga Community Center. You will see a List of Forums.

If you don't see it, click on Forum on the top menu.

 

forums list

 

Click on the forum you wish to view, post or reply in.

Registered users can view, post or reply in all forums.  Unregistered users can read postings in all forums.

Don't forget to read John's Sticky posting in each forum, which can be found at the top of the list of postings. It contains important information about the each forum.

 

Each forum is organized into Threads, which are listed under the name of the forum.

Each Thread has an original posting and any replies that are made to it.

This makes it easier to find postings and their respective replies.

(If you wish to reply to an existing thread, click on on the name of the thread which appears as a link, then click on Reply.  Then follow the instructions below.)

 

If you want to make a new posting, you must create a New Thread. Click on the blue button Post New Thread.
